Missions
Develop, fabricate, and validate microsystems for the controlled orientation of micro-cameras integrated into endoscopes.
Design and optimize soft micro-actuators based on Electroactive Conductive Polymers (ECPs).
Perform multiphysics modeling and simulations of the microsystems.
Carry out microfabrication and integration of microsystems in a cleanroom environment.
Characterize prototypes electro-mechanically and under various environmental conditions (temperature, humidity).
Participate in functional testing and experimental validation, including with medical partners.
Contribute to scientific output: publications, presentations, and patents.
Activités
Design and modeling: multiphysics modeling of micro-actuators and the complete system to optimize performance and precision.
Microfabrication: use of micro- and nano-structured technologies on flexible substrates.
Integration: assembly of micro-cameras and micro-actuators into active endoscope prototypes.
Characterization: electro-mechanical testing, performance measurements, and environmental condition trials.
Interdisciplinary collaboration: interactions with biomedical teams and international academic partners.
Scientific dissemination: writing articles, presenting at conferences, and participating in technology transfer and patenting activities.
